Step-by-step explanation:
in order to solve for m in the expression K=2L-7NM , we will first combine the like terms and then express m int erms of k,n and l.
<u>solution</u>
K=2L-7NM
combine the like terms
K + 7NM = 2L
7NM = 2L -K
Divide both sides by 7N
7NM/7N = (2L -K)/7N
M = (2L -K)/7N
Therefore from the question K=2L-7NM M is evaluated to be M = (2L -K)/7N

Step-by-step explanation:
Ratios are a way to represent of how much there is one thing to another. It's a more simplistic representation.
For example, if there were 625 adults and 375 children, we don't say there are 625 adults to 375 children, we say there are 5 adults to 3 children.
All I did was divide both the number of children and adults by 125 and we have a ratio of 5:3 for adults to children respectively.
In this problem, we have a ratio of 3:2 for girls to boys. This 3:2 ratio is a simplistic representation of the number of girls to boys. We know that there are 24 boys.
Dividing 24/2 = 12
12 is the proportion which we multiply by the ratio to get the true numbers for boys and girls.
2 * 12 = 24 boys
3 * 12 = 36 girls
So there are 36 girls in the marching band.
